O’FALLON, Mo. – Jacob Eberhart quickly lived up to the preseason hype.
The Kirkwood senior helped lead a sterling defensive effort and had a record-breaking night on offense in the Pioneers’ 10-3 win over Fort Zumwalt West in the teams’ non-conference season opener Thursday night at West’s Hoekel Stadium.
“Offense, we’ve got some stuff to clean up, but defense made a stand. The most important thing is we got the dub,†said Eberhart, a University of Illinois commit. “I’m grateful that I get to play both sides of the ball under a head coach like Jeremy Maclin. It just means so much. I came out here and gave this team my all, like I always do.â€
Eberhart had 11 receptions for 156 yards and a touchdown — the game’s only TD. The 11 catches set a new Kirkwood record for receptions in a game, besting the previous mark of 10 set by three players.

“He’s a stud, man,†Maclin said. “At any given moment, he’s the best guy on the field. He does a lot of really, really good things for us both offensively and defensively.â€
Pioneers defense stands out
The Kirkwood defense held West out of the end zone and permitted just one field goal early in the fourth quarter.
“The defense got smaller since we lost a few pieces, but we’ve got everybody firing,†Eberhart said. “The defense is going to play every time. Defense wins championships.â€
Jaguars offense sputters
On the flip side, West couldn’t get much going on the offensive end.
The Jaguars —who got a 26-yard Cade Williams field goal in the fourth quarter to avoid a shutout — saw their best chance to score a TD with a drive inside the Pioneer 10-yard-line late in the first half, but an interception on a 50/50 ball in the end zone ended the threat.
“Points were tough to come by,†West coach Ben Pike said. “We had some opportunities, but we just didn’t come down with it. I thought we had one in the back of the end zone there for a touchdown, but the refs didn’t see it that way, so that is what it is.â€
Stars come out to shine
The season-opening matchup featured two of the top-10 players on the Post-Dispatch Super 30 preseason list of senior prospects.
Eberhart, the No. 3 player on the list, did what he did to lead Kirkwood and No. 9 Garrick Dixon, a Kansas State commit, also had a couple of big plays for West.
Eberhart cherished the matchup with another high-level player.
“Iron sharpens iron,†he said. “I’m gonna hit him up after this and tell him best of luck. But at the end of the day, may the best man win.â€
Big opening drive
West won the opening coin toss, but deferred and Kirkwood took advantage with an 18-play, 65-yard drive that gobbled the first 7 minutes, 58 seconds off the clock and culminated in Eberhart’s dazzling 21-yard TD catch.
The opening drive, though, was not without its hiccups for the Pioneers, who had a pair of TDs called back because of penalties.
“It starts with me,†Maclin said. “I call the plays, so clearly I didn’t have us as prepared as we should have been.â€
Wild end to first half
The Pioneers drove to the red zone late in the first half, but looked as though it had run out of time on the clock.
But with the Jaguars headed to the locker room and the West marching band on the field, the officials put enough time back on the clock for the Pioneers to run two more plays and then get a 22-yard field goal from Joey Evans to take a 10-0 lead into the halftime locker room.
“It was tough, but you got to kind of roll with it whether I agree with it or not,†Pike said. “Thankfully, we got guys back out and got them calmed down to where we at least held them to a field goal.â€
Up next
Kirkwood is back on the road in Week 2 with a Sept. 5 game at Pattonville (0-1), which lost its season opener to Fort Zumwalt North on Thursday.
“Nothing’s easy,†Maclin said. “Always very, very well-coached. They play hard. They’re gonna fight to the end, no matter what.â€
Zumwalt West will try to get in the win column next week when it travels across the Missouri and Mississippi rivers to play at Belleville West (0-0), which features another Illinois commit in Nick Hankins Jr.
“They are a team that’s always got a lot of good athletes and the coach over there has done a good job of starting to get that program turned around,†Pike said. “We know it’ll be another tough test for us, but we’ll get our guys refocused and ready to go for next week.â€
